Transaction 80f11dfc76a9b52e2f4b52521459c41144459f460809860f0ae41ebb5c09c15a
1 Input
2 Outputs
- 80f11dfc76a9b52e2f4b52521459c41144459f460809860f0ae41ebb5c09c15a:0
- 80f11dfc76a9b52e2f4b52521459c41144459f460809860f0ae41ebb5c09c15a:1
value 475200000
address 1E3V4ANt5SD2WDE7GLt86GWnGgHr6AsXvS
value 9854081107
address 1511xwg4D2pCMdcQu7BoToD1ciCA97ZqtA